Img 6839Discover the beauty of botanical forms through your own creative lens in this flexible, drop-in workshop experience. Drawing inspiration from Kim Chong Hak’s vivid interpretations of nature and treasures from our permanent collection, explore multiple creative stations at your own pace—experimenting with preserved floral elements, watercolor, and written prompts.

What to Expect:

  • Create and take home: 3-4 watercolor and botanical studies, ready to take home the same day
  • Self-guided exploration: Come and go as you please throughout the 2.5-hour workshop window
  • Multiple creative stations: featuring preserved floral elements, art materials, and written prompts
  • No structured instruction: This is your time to explore and create freely!
  • Perfect for all skill levels: Bring your curiosity, we will provide the materials.

Meet the Artist

Skye Lin, an interdisciplinary artist and designer, has carved a unique niche in the creative landscape. With a BFA in sculpture and installation art, Lin’s expertise spans photography, artistic direction, scenography, and large-scale installations. Her portfolio includes collaborations with industry titans such as Disney, Art Basel, British Vogue, and ELLE magazine. Lin is the owner of Pinker Times, an innovative brick-and-mortar space that seamlessly blends retail, exhibitions, and floral workshops. For more information, please visit pinkertimes.com.
